How to Register for a Program
How do I register?
To register for a recreation program, please click on the "Recreation and Special Events" tab. From there, you can choose programs for kids, teens, and adults. Click on a program to find out more details, the date, and price. If you haven't already created an account, you will be prompted to do so. You can then complete your registration online by submitting a Visa or MasterCard payment securely.
I'm a Tualatin resident. Is there a resident rate on programs?
Yes! All Tualatin residents are eligible for the resident rate on all programs, classes and activities offered by the Recreation Division. Non-residents of the City of Tualatin must pay a surcharge of 25% to participate. Non-residents who own property or a business in the city are exempt from the non-resident surcharge.
What are the cancelation and refund policies?
Programs are subject to cancelation due to weather, low enrollment, or other reasons outside of our control. If you are enrolled in a program that cancels, you will be notified by telephone in advance and a full refund will be made. It is our policy to refund 100% of program fees if your withdrawal notice is given 7 or more days before the start date of the program. A 50% refund will be given if withdrawal notice is given less than 7 days before the start date of the program. Program fees are not refunded for withdrawals less than 24 hours before the start of the program.
